Fighter Jets Enforce No-Fly Zone Near Mar-A-Lago

Fighter jets had to enforce a no-fly-zone for the second time in one weekend. A pair of U.S. Air Force F-16s reportedly sent to Palm Beach County to prevent a plane from getting too close to Mar-A-Lago.Once the jets got close they radioed the plane. The pilot left without incident.
